If your dog is a little shy, consider booking a one-night trial stay! This practice run can boost your and your dog’s confidence before your trip.
Preparing for drop-off is easy when you have a checklist! To help your dog settle into their Montoursville home-away-from-home, we recommend packing:
- Health and safety essentials such as their ID tags, vaccination records, medication, and emergency vet or secondary caregiver contacts.
- Food and gear such as harnesses, collars, food (portioned by day), and an item that smells like you.
- Special instructions such as a list of training cues, medical administration needs, or favorite hang-out spots in your Montoursville.
Tip: You can upload your dog’s routine and medical info directly onto their profile so your sitter always has the details at their fingertips.

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.
Many sitters in PA 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ies.
By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.
